Fashion Alchemy Is Now A Important Ideal For Fashion Companies World Wide

By Tom Brady


Trish Hinders is the owner and creative force behind a very important company. The firm in question, is the Fashion Alchemy brand of nature friendly clothing. Her inspirations come from many trips to India which also gave her a deep appreciation of mysticism and yoga. India has also given rise to the materials that Trish uses to create her stunning designs.

Amongst the most significant sources of supply and stimulation that inspire this modern designer's efforts are the time-honoured silk saris of India. The sari (also known as the saree or the shari) has been a commonly worn female garment all over Southern Asia for centuries and is increasingly popular in European countries that have witnessed large influxes of Indian migrants. Saris are crafted from one entire bit of fabric varying in length from 5 to 9 yards and in width between 2 and 4 feet.

Trish re-uses this vibrant cloth in her Sitara collection of environmentally-friendly tailoring and accessories. These beautiful drapes symbolise the native cultures of Sri Lanka, Bangladesh and India. When women discard their aging saris in favour of newer patterns (in this day and age ever more composed of synthetic fibres), Sitara purchases the garments disposed of and reprocesses them to craft eye-catching new creations.

The word "sari" derives from the ancient Sanskrit language, where it was known as a "sati", the term for a strip of material. Saris can be traced as far back as the Indus Valley civilization which dominated the western Indian sub-continent from 2,800 to 1,800 BC. These exquisite drapes exposed the midriff as the navel is believed to be the sacred source of creation and life.
